Dental implants function a groundbreaking answer for individuals looking for to exchange missing teeth. They are designed to mix in with the natural teeth, restoring functionality and aesthetics. However, sure life-style decisions can pose challenges in the profitable placement and longevity of these implants. One notable issue is smoking, which regularly raises issues amongst each dental professionals and sufferers.


Smokers regularly face issues in various elements of health, together with oral health. The adverse results of tobacco on the body are intensive, influencing blood circulation, healing processes, and the immune response. When it comes to dental implants, a wholesome healing setting is paramount, and smoking undermines this essential requirement.


The risk of infection, a vital consideration when placing dental implants, will increase considerably among smokers. Nicotine constricts blood vessels, reducing blood move to the gum tissues. This diminished circulation can delay therapeutic and compromise the mixing of the implant into the bone. Effective osseointegration, the process by which the implant bonds to the jawbone, is essential to its success. When the therapeutic course of is hindered, the likelihood of implant failure escalates.

Moreover, smokers are inclined to expertise a higher incidence of periodontal disease, a condition that may further complicate the implantation course of. Healthy gums are essential for the soundness of implants. If pre-existing gum disease is current, it could have to be handled previous to contemplating implants. Engaging in smoking can also exacerbate these conditions, creating a vicious cycle that may go away potential candidates struggling to attain the specified outcomes from their dental implant procedures.


The success of dental implants also hinges on the patient’s dedication to oral hygiene. Smokers could face extra obstacles in maintaining optimum oral hygiene because of the effects of tobacco on their gums. This can foster an environment the place micro organism thrive, considerably rising the risk of complications and implant failure. Regular dental check-ups and complete oral care routines become much more crucial for smokers than for non-smokers.

While there are evident challenges for smokers in obtaining dental implants, it isn't impossible. Many dental professionals advocate taking measures to mitigate the risks related to smoking. One effective technique is cessation of smoking each before and after the implant placement. The periodical discouragement of smoking often ends in improved blood circulation and therapeutic capabilities. Some studies counsel that quitting smoking no less than 4 to six weeks before the procedure can enhance the probabilities of profitable outcomes.
